kodi-retroarch-advanced-launchers: move to pkgs/by-name, format with nixfmt-rfc-style

+12 -8
+12 -5
pkgs/applications/emulators/retroarch/kodi-advanced-launchers.nix pkgs/by-name/ko/kodi-retroarch-advanced-launchers/package.nix
··· 1 - { stdenv, pkgs, lib, runtimeShell, cores ? [ ] }: 1 + { 2 + stdenv, 3 + pkgs, 4 + lib, 5 + runtimeShell, 6 + cores ? [ ], 7 + }: 2 8 3 9 let 4 - 5 10 script = exec: '' 6 11 #!${runtimeShell} 7 12 nohup sh -c "pkill -SIGTSTP kodi" & 8 13 # https://forum.kodi.tv/showthread.php?tid=185074&pid=1622750#pid1622750 9 14 nohup sh -c "sleep 10 && ${exec} '$@' -f;pkill -SIGCONT kodi" 10 15 ''; 11 - scriptSh = exec: pkgs.writeScript ("kodi-"+exec.name) (script exec.path); 12 - execs = map (core: rec { name = core.core; path = core+"/bin/retroarch-"+name;}) cores; 13 - 16 + scriptSh = exec: pkgs.writeScript ("kodi-" + exec.name) (script exec.path); 17 + execs = map (core: rec { 18 + name = core.core; 19 + path = core + "/bin/retroarch-" + name; 20 + }) cores; 14 21 in 15 22 16 23 stdenv.mkDerivation {
-3
pkgs/top-level/all-packages.nix
··· 1478 1478 1479 1479 libretro = recurseIntoAttrs (callPackage ../applications/emulators/retroarch/cores.nix { }); 1480 1480 1481 - kodi-retroarch-advanced-launchers = 1482 - callPackage ../applications/emulators/retroarch/kodi-advanced-launchers.nix { }; 1483 - 1484 1481 # Aliases kept here because they are easier to use 1485 1482 x16-emulator = x16.emulator; 1486 1483 x16-rom = x16.rom;